SUMMARY

The program was not able to update a record in the specified file.  This could be due to an error returned by the Operating System or a data corruption problem.

Specific Errors

Note: The "x" in the following error message(s) acts as a numeric wildcard and can represent any number. Information about these numbers and the codes they represent can be found in KB Article R10044, "How to Interpret Fatal Error Messages."
